Missouri S&T ranks eighth in ROI report

Posted by on April 18, 2017

Missouri University of Science and Technology is one of the best values in higher education, according to the 2017 PayScale College ROI Report. Missouri S&T ranks eighth in the nation for annual return on investment (ROI), according to the PayScale report, with an average annual ROI of 11.7 percent over 20 years. That puts Missouri S&T sixth among public universities for in-state students and first among Missouri colleges and universities.

Missouri S&T students build competition-ready canoe out of concrete

Posted by on April 14, 2017

Students from Missouri University of Science and Technology have built a 250-pound canoe out of concrete and will prove that it floats during the American Society of Civil Engineers’ 2017 Mid-Continent Student Conference.

Missouri S&T awards Chancellor’s Scholarships

Posted by on April 13, 2017

Missouri University of Science and Technology awarded Chancellor’s Scholarships to 18 high school seniors for the 2017-2018 academic year. To qualify for the scholarship, students must be Missouri residents, have a cumulative grade point average of at least 3.75 or rank in the upper 10 percent of their high school graduation class and have ACT composite scores of 31 or better. The students also must complete a 750-word essay and participate in an on-campus interview.
